Can copyright protected furniture be imported from abroad?

Furniture can be copyright protected. For example, the Supreme Court upheld the protectability (pdf 56 KB, in German) of Le Corbusier chairs. If you want to import copyright protected furniture from countries where the copyright protection has already expired and unlicensed manufacturing is thus permitted, the decisive point is whether they are for private use or for another purpose (such as resale). In the second case, it would be infringement of copyrights. If you order furniture over the internet, the delivery may be viewed as an illegal export on the part of the foreign trader (not as an ‘import for private use’) and the furniture would be confiscated at the border.  more
